It came with my Crosshair. I just assumed it would come with the other high end boards with the SoundMAX chip in it. I haven't checked to see if yours came with it or not.

Are you using the driver off of the CD or the latest driver from Asus's site? Version 6.10.X.6480.

I had the same issue with Vista64 and my mic. I found that driver version 6.10.1.6270 worked for me where the others did not.

I have since switched over to the Sound Blaster X-Fi XtremeGamer Fatal1ty card so can not say how the newest driver works for me.
